  10. SoCal (South OC) to UT NPs

    Just enjoyed Utah's National Parks. Total miles driven 1,885 miles averaged 2.04 miles/kWh. Charing started at 100% from home. Used RAN only once in LV. All other DCFC chargers at Tesla SC with the membership the I'd signed up just for the road trip - much lower cost than RAN. Now cancelled...
